To reliably fix a sleeve in both directions in the shaft direction by a simple means by fixing a plate and one side surface of a wall by a swelling part brought about by a sphere having a diameter larger than a sleeve hole in which its opposite side surface is pressed from the opposite side end of a flange of the sleeve by the flange of the sleeve.
A sleeve is inserted into an opening of a plate 5 until a flange 2 collides with a left side surface of the plate 5, and is supported by a proper method. A sphere 9 having a diameter larger than a diameter of a hole in a range of an end part of the sleeve is pressed in a hole of the sleeve from the opposite side end of the flange 2 of the sleeve by a punch 8, and an outside diameter of the sleeve is diametrically expanded thereby. The sphere 9 is deeply pressed in a right side surface 10 on the opposite side of a left side surface of the plate 5 as a swelling part 11 to fix the sleeve to the plate 5 by pressing the plate 5 against the flange 2 is generated. As a result, the sleeve having the flange 2 can be fixed to the opening of the plate 5.
